javascript - 选择所有包含 &lt;input&gt; 和 <section> 标签的 <table> 标签

标签 javascript jquery html jquery-selectors

如何选择所有 <table>具有 <input> 的标签和 <section>在其中标记 - 通过 jQuery?

类似于:

var tables_with_input = $( "table" that_contain input,section)  ///pseudo code

最佳答案

您可以使用 :has为此,它检查匹配元素是否包含某些元素等。

$('table:has(input, section)')

FIDDLE

关于javascript - 选择所有包含 &lt;input&gt; 和 <section> 标签的 <table> 标签,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25890862/

相关文章:

html - 对齐图像

javascript - 将鼠标悬停在菜单上时在特定 Div 上显示图标

jquery - 我需要使用 : when specifying a jQuery selector?

javascript - 从javascript中删除双引号

javascript - 如何从 UWP c# 上的 appdata 中的 html 接收 scriptNotify

javascript - Angular 应用程序保护和用户身份验证

javascript - 隐藏/显示 div 不起作用

javascript - Bluebird中的捕获错误类型不起作用

javascript - 从预输入中选择建议后无法设置文本字段值

javascript - 从php文件在谷歌地图中刷新经纬度